OREF Grants

OREF offers a number of opportunities in 2 grant cycles each year.  RFAs go live in March and November of each year.

  • Sports Medicine Multicenter Research Grant
    • $4000,000 over 2 years
    • Funds proposals focused on the broad areas of sports medicine multicenter research trials
  • OREF Etiology of Hip Osetoarthritis Grant in Honor of William H Harris, MD
    • $250,000 over 2 years
    • Funds investigator-initiated research proposals focused on the etiology of hip OA
  • OREF/AAOS Injectable Orthobiologics Knee OA Research Grant
    • $50,000 over one year
    • Focused on the broad area of injectable orthobiologics for the treatment of knee osteoarthritis
  • OREF Treatment of OA Research Grant funded by the Arthritis Foundation
    • $50,000 over one year
    • Funds proposals that aim to help us better understand how to prevent and treat OA
  • The OREF Impact of Regulatory Policies on the Patient-Physician Relationship Research Grant in Honor of Sigvard Hansen, MD
    • $75,000 over one year
    • Fund proposals that explore the impact of regulatory practices on the patient-physician relationship.
  • Resident Research Project Grant – RD1
    • $5,000 over one year
    • Provides funding to residents who are interested in research.

NCTraCS Pilot Funding Program

The North Carolina Translational and Clinical Sciences Institute (NCTraCS) provides a variety of pilot funding opportunities to facilitate the transfer of research findings to clinical practice in order to improve the health of the people of North Carolina. Multiple grant mechanisms are available.
